Lalitha Mahal Palace Hotel

Mysuru’s luxurious palace-heritage hotel

HERITAGE ATTRACTIONSMYSURU ATTRACTIONS

Introduction

Lalitha Mahal Palace stands as Mysore’s second largest palace, built to host British royalty. Now a heritage hotel, it is enchanting with Renaissance architecture, royal interiors, and regal hospitality.

Did You Know?

  • Constructed in 1921 for the Viceroy of India.
  • Features Italian marble and Venetian chandeliers.
  • The palace’s exquisite murals depict Mysore’s royal history.
  • Offers luxurious accommodations blending history and comfort.

How to Reach

Located 5 km from Mysore Palace. Nearest airport Mysore Domestic Airport (15 km). Connected by road and rail from Mysore city center.
